Transaction 5762c06f39786cd64ba5fde0d96a9ae083db3c06b1c639d54e14305e144d9174
1 Input
1 Output
-
5762c06f39786cd64ba5fde0d96a9ae083db3c06b1c639d54e14305e144d9174:0
- value
- 152357826
- script pubkey
- OP_0 OP_PUSHBYTES_20 670c460009f966843ffe21ff18bfd8778557beaa
- address
- bc1qvuxyvqqfl9ngg0l7y8l3307cw7z40042842pd7